Licking County Medical Reserve Corps “The Medical Reserve Corps (MRC) is a national network of volunteers, organized locally to improve the health and safety of their communities."

The MRC network comprises 993 community-based units and 207,783 volunteers located throughout the United States and its territories. The MRC is sponsored by the Office of the U.S Surgeon General. Members include professionals working in and around the healthcare industry, or a health related field, within the Licking County, Ohio area, or professionals who live in the Licking County communities. It takes about 20 secs of hand washing with soap/water to effectively kill germs, according to CDC.

In a recent study, scientists found that only 5% of people who used the bathroom washed their hands long enough to kill germs that can cause infections.

Washing your hands properly is one of the most important things you can do to help prevent and control the spread of many illnesses. Good hand hygiene will reduce the risk of things like flu, food poisoning and healthcare associated infections being passed from person to person.
